Recurrent Hypothermia and Autonomic Dysfunction Secondary to Shapiro Syndrome
ABSTRACT A 44‐year‐old man presented with recurrent hypothermia, diaphoresis and hypertension. Extensive investigation for infectious, inflammatory, metabolic and endocrine aetiologies was negative. MR scan of the brain demonstrated no lesions but revealed callosal dysgenesis, consistent with Shapiro syndrome.

DiffFNO: Diffusion Fourier Neural Operator
We introduce DiffFNO, a novel diffusion framework for arbitrary-scale super-resolution strengthened by a Weighted Fourier Neural Operator (WFNO). Mode Rebalancing in WFNO effectively captures critical frequency components, significantly improving the reconstruction of high-frequency image details that are crucial for super-resolution tasks.

On the projections of Laplacians under Riemannian submersions
We give a condition on Riemannian submersions from a Riemannian manifold M to a Riemannian manifold N which will ensure that it induces a differential operator on N from the Laplace-Beltrami operator on M.
